James Lois Ellis was born September 15, 1941 in Coushatta, Louisiana to Lois and Elizabeth Gatheright Ellis. He passed away on January 31, 2021 in Shreveport, Louisiana.
At the age of 19, James proudly enlisted in the US Army. He served during the Vietnam War, where he was injured, earning him a Purple Heart. He served as a Sgt. in the 101st airborne. In August of 1968, James married the love of his life, Barbara Christian Ellis. He loved to give Barbara a hard time, and when asked how he was doing, would reply, "I have 5 hungry kids and a mad wife". James loved his children and would be at every one of their sporting events, cheering them on. You could always hear him yelling "you got peanut butter in your whistle ref". He enjoyed watching the Atlanta Braves, but would get frustrated when they were losing. James had a hot temper, but the biggest heart. He loved to travel. He traveled so much, his truck has 590,000 miles on it, and has friends throughout the United States who will miss him dearly. He never met a stranger and would sit and talk to all. His greatest joy in life was his grandchildren. He adored them more than anything else. He also enjoyed drinking his coffee every morning with his crew at Sharon's Café. James lived his life to the fullest and will be greatly missed by all.
